Andrej Martin enters the Prague Challenger qualifying draw as the higher-ranked player at No. 402 with a career-high of 93, compared to Saba Purtseladze at No. 646. Martin has posted several wins on clay in 2026, including a recent three-set victory in Bratislava, while Purtseladze arrives after a straight-sets win in Hamburg but holds a more limited professional record. The match on outdoor clay favors the veteran Slovak’s experience and consistency against the younger Georgian’s aggressive baseline game. Limited prior head-to-head history leaves recent form, surface comfort, and physical freshness as the main variables traders are weighing ahead of the early-morning qualifier.

This market will resolve to 'Andrej Martin' if Andrej Martin advances against Saba Purtseladze.
This market will resolve to 'Saba Purtseladze' if Saba Purtseladze advances against Andrej Martin.
If the match is canceled (not played at all), ends in a tie, or is delayed beyond 7 days from the scheduled date without a winner determined, this market will resolve to 50-50.
If the match begins but is not completed, and one player advances due to the opponent's retirement, default, or disqualification, this market will resolve to the player who advances.
If the match ends in a walkover (player withdraws before the start and the other advances automatically), this market will resolve to 50-50.
The primary resolution source will be official information from the ATP Tour. A consensus of credible reporting may also be used.
